Mercedes-Benz is a famous German brand of automobiles, buses, coaches, and trucks owned by DaimlerChrysler.

The brand originated in 1926 when the companies Benz & Cie.and DMG (Daimler Motoren Gesellschaft) originally founded by Gottlieb Daimler merged. Daimler had died in 1900 and Maybach, his chief collaborator, had left DMG in 1909. In 1924 the two companies entered an agreement to remain associated until 2000. This initial agreement left each company to manufacture and sell products with their original brands. In 1926 a formal merger occurred and the new brand that both companies would share Mercedes Benz was created.

The origins of the company date back to the mid 1880s, when Daimler and Benz invented the internal combustion engine.

The company is most famous for limousine models, nonetheless a number of notable sports cars also have been produced. For example, the early supercharged SSK developed by Ferdinand Porsche, and the Gullwing 300SL in 1954. Mercedes Benz also has produced higher volume, less expensive cars, however. In 1958 Mercedes-Benz entered a distribution agreement with the Studebaker Packard Corporation of South Bend, Indiana (USA), makers of Studebaker and Packard brand automobiles. Under the deal, Studebaker allowed Mercedes Benz access to their US dealer network, handle shipments of vehicles to those dealers, and in return receive compensation for each car sale.

When Studebaker entered into informal discussions with Franco American automaker Facel Vega on offering their Facel Vega Excellence model in the US, Mercedes Benz objected. Studebaker, which needed Mercedes-Benz distribution payments to help stem heavy losses, dropped further action on the plan.

Mercedes Benz maintained an office in the Studebaker works in South Bend from 1958 to 1963 when Studebaker's U.S. operations ceased. Many U.S. Studebaker dealers converted to Mercedes-Benz dealerships at that time. When Studebaker closed its Canadian operation and left the automobile business in 1966, remaining Studebaker dealers had the option to convert their dealerships to Mercedes Benz dealership agreements.

From 1926 Mercedes & Benz, were successful in motor racing throughout their separate histories, both having entries in the first automobile race in 1894. The Mercedes Simplex of the early 1900s, built by Daimler Motors (DMG), was the first purpose built race car, much lower than usual designs, which were similar to horse carriages; it dominated racing for years. In 1914, just before the beginning of the First World War, the Daimler Mercedes 35hp won the French Grand Prix.

In 1993 Mercedes-Benz made its return to Formula One as engine supplier to the debut F1 team Sauber, with a V10 engine manufactured by Ilmor. In 1995, the normally aspirated Mercedes-Benz-Ilmor F1-V10 moved to McLaren. The team had great success, under Mika Häkkinen.
